South Korea Air Source Heat Pump Market By Type Segment Analysis

The South Korean air source heat pump (ASHP) market can be segmented primarily into air-to-air and air-to-water systems. Air-to-air heat pumps are designed to provide heating and cooling directly through air circulation, making them suitable for residential and commercial applications seeking energy-efficient climate control. Conversely, air-to-water heat pumps transfer heat to water systems, supporting space heating, hot water supply, and industrial processes. Currently, the market size for air-to-water systems is estimated to account for approximately 60% of the total ASHP market, driven by their versatility in larger-scale applications and integration with existing hydronic systems. Air-to-air systems, while constituting around 40%, are predominantly favored in smaller residential settings due to their straightforward installation and lower upfront costs.

Over the forecast period, the air-to-water segment is expected to exhibit the highest growth rate, with a projected CAGR of around 12% over the next 5–10 years, driven by increasing government incentives for renewable heating solutions and rising urbanization. The market for air-to-air heat pumps is at a more mature stage, characterized by widespread adoption in residential sectors and incremental technological improvements. The growth accelerators for air-to-water systems include advancements in compressor efficiency, integration with smart home systems, and favorable regulatory policies promoting low-carbon heating technologies. Innovations such as inverter-driven compressors and enhanced refrigerants are further boosting performance and energy savings, reinforcing the segment’s growth trajectory. As the industry matures, emphasis on hybrid systems combining heat pumps with traditional boilers is expected to optimize energy consumption and reduce costs, fostering further market expansion.

Regulatory Framework & Policy Impact on South Korea Air Source Heat Pump Market

South Korea’s regulatory landscape is highly supportive of renewable heating technologies, with policies emphasizing decarbonization and energy efficiency. The government’s Green New Deal and National Energy Master Plan include specific targets for heat pump deployment, backed by substantial subsidies, tax incentives, and standards that favor high-efficiency units.

Building codes increasingly mandate the integration of renewable energy systems, and urban planning policies promote green building certifications that favor heat pump adoption. Regulatory support extends to R&D funding for innovative technologies and pilot projects, fostering a robust ecosystem for market expansion. However, evolving standards require continuous compliance efforts from manufacturers and stakeholders.
